Spanish national consumer prices rose 1.7 percent year-on-year in November according to data from the National Statistics Institute on Friday, compared to 2.3 percent in October and a Reuters poll forecast of 1.7 percent.

Spanish European Union-harmonised prices rose 1.7 percent from a year earlier, down from 2.3 percent in October and in line with the Reuters forecast.

Core inflation, which strips out volatile food and energy  prices, was 0.9 percent year on year, compared to a reading of 1.0 percent a month earlier.
